Terrorism Index in Nepal decreased to 1.11 Points in 2024 from 2.16 Points in 2023. Terrorism Index in Nepal averaged 4.95 Points from 2002 until 2024, reaching an all time high of 6.86 Points in 2004 and a record low of 1.11 Points in 2024. source: Institute for Economics and Peace

Nepal Terrorism Index
The Global Terrorism Index measures the direct and indirect impact of terrorism, including its effects on lives lost, injuries, property damage and the psychological aftereffects. It is a composite score that ranks countries according to the impact of terrorism from 0 (no impact) to 10 (highest impact).
